Abstract
A drying light source (1), in which the light of a number of single light sources (3) is applied heterodyned and bundled to an object level (5) with the help of optical elements (6, 4, 7, 8).

2. Drying light source (1) for illuminating an object with plural high power LEDs, the drying light source comprising:
-
at least one first individual illumination source (3) comprising at least one high power LED requiring substantial heat dissipation and a second individual light source (3′
) comprising at least one high power LED requiring substantial heat dissipation, whereby their emitted light respectively has a dominant wave length (λ
1, and/or λ
2), and providing a converged beam light beam bundle;a collector (8); optic means (6, 6′
, 4, 4′
) providing heterodyning of the emitted light and providing homogenization of the converged light beam bundle realized with a micro lens array; andthe high power LEDs having a spacing to allow separation of the LEDs to reduce a tendency of interference, thereby avoiding overheating, wherein the optic means comprise at least one beam divider (4), whereby the beam divider is mounted and designed in such a way that the emitted light (λ
1) of the first light source (3) is reflected onto the object field (5) that is to be illuminated and the emitted light (λ
2) of the second individual light source (3′
) can pass unhindered in order to heterodyne itself with the emitted light (λ
1) of the first light source (3). - View Dependent Claims (3, 4, 5, 6, 11, 12, 13)
